Alfa Romeo 147 P1637 Engine Trouble Code

Powertrain Code P1637

What is Alfa Romeo 147 P1637?

Alfa Romeo 147 P1637 code can indicate a faulty oxygen sensor, which may eventually damage the catalytic converter (repair cost: $2,000–$2,200). Professional diagnosis costs around $200–$210. Oxygen sensors are often straightforward to replace — check your owner's manual for location and instructions. This issue should be addressed promptly to prevent further damage.

P1637 on the Alfa Romeo 147

Independent workshop data shows that Alfa Romeo 147 vehicles with P1637 resolve approximately 40% of cases after a throttle body cleaning and idle relearn procedure. This is always the recommended first step before investing in new sensors.

P1637 Alfa Romeo 147 Engine Diagram

Code Information

Code Type:OBD-II Powertrain (P) Trouble Code
System:Powertrain
Vehicle:Alfa Romeo 147
Brand:Alfa
Model:Romeo 147
Code:P1637

P1637 Alfa Romeo 147 Symptoms

⚠️

Check Engine Light

Illuminated Alfa Romeo 147 dashboard warning

🔧

Engine Stalling

Engine stops unexpectedly or misfires

Performance Issues

Reduced power or acceleration on the Alfa Romeo 147

🚫

Starting Problems

Difficulty starting the engine

Poor Fuel Economy

Increased fuel consumption on the Alfa Romeo 147

💨

Increased Emissions

Failed emissions test due to P1637

P1637 Code Structure

Understanding what each digit means in the P1637 powertrain trouble code:

P 1 6 3 7
Powertrain Code Fuel And Air Metering Fuel Temperature Sensor B Circuit Range/Performance Injection Pump Fuel Metering Control 'A' High Shift/Timing Solenoid Malfunction

How to Fix Alfa Romeo 147 P1637

Diagnostic Steps:

Regarding P1637, carefully inspect the wire harness near the intake manifold bracket, best accessed from below near the oil filter. Look for chafing, pinching, or damaged insulation.

Repair Solution:

Most manufacturers number cylinders sequentially from front to back. Ford V-engines start with cylinder 1 at front left. In V-6 engines, cylinder 4 is front right; in V-8 engines, cylinder 5 occupies that position.

Technical Notes:

For P1637, verify VCT solenoid operation. Look for stuck or sticking valves caused by contamination. Consult vehicle-specific repair manual for proper component testing procedures.

Alfa Romeo 147 P1637 Repair Cost

The EVAP purge valve is among the cheapest P1637 fixes on the Alfa Romeo 147: the part itself retails for $25–$60 and installation takes under 30 minutes. A DIY-capable owner can complete this repair at home, keeping total expenditure below $80.

P1637 Description

P1637 engine trouble code is related to Shift/Timing Solenoid Malfunction.

Main Cause

The primary reason for P1637 OBD-II Engine Trouble Code is: Fuel Temperature Sensor B Circuit Range/Performance.

Common P1637 Misdiagnosis on the Alfa Romeo 147

A common error on the Alfa Romeo 147 is attributing P1637 to the crankshaft position sensor when the real fault is a damaged flywheel ring gear. The missing tooth pattern created by ring gear damage is intermittent and generates the same signal anomaly.

DIY Repair Guide: P1637 on Alfa Romeo 147

For Alfa Romeo 147 owners without a scan tool, a free diagnostic check is available at most franchised Alfa dealers during a courtesy health-check appointment. This provides the DTC number needed to research the exact cause of P1637 before committing to any repair.

Preventing P1637 on the Alfa Romeo 147

Transmission fluid degradation on the Alfa Romeo 147 directly affects solenoid operation. Replacing ATF at 40,000-mile intervals (rather than the often-quoted 'lifetime fill' recommendation) is the best insurance against shift-solenoid codes including P1637.

Frequently Asked Questions — Alfa Romeo 147 P1637

Q: My Alfa Romeo 147 has P1637 but no drivability symptoms — is that possible?
A: Yes. Some fault conditions, particularly those involving EVAP system leaks or marginal sensor readings, store codes without producing noticeable drivability symptoms. These are called memory faults and still need to be addressed because they will eventually cause performance issues.

Search Another Code